, когда [jarrett] решил ввести конкурс 555, который только что завершился, он наклонился к идее, которая была гремить в своем ноге в течение нескольких Годы: использование 555 таймеров для отправления отвала прошивки на микроконтроллере. Это абсолютно не тот инструмент для работы, но [Джарретт] получил его работать и задокументировал его в HackAday.io.
Предпосылка заключается в том, что путем прерывания источника питания микроконтроллера STM8 в самом идеальном времени и только для идеальной продолжительности он пропустил бы инструкции, рассказывая о том, что ее прошивки не позволяют прочитать его прошивку. Время и продолжительность … То, что 555 хорошо известно, что способны. Однако возникла проблема.
Первая проблема заключается в том, что продолжительность должна была измеряться в наносекундах. Разнообразие 555 сада может позволить только до 10 микросекунд. Решение? Ну, вам придется прочитать исключительную страницу проекта, чтобы узнать, но не волнуйтесь – это 555. Вторая проблема? Он использовал 555-х годов!
Был [Джарретт] успешно? После долгих возобновляемых и промахов он абсолютно был! Старая прошивка была расположена из процессора STM8, и новая прошивка может быть прошевлена безнаказанностью.
Этот конкурс 555 видел некоторые действительно эпические записи, в том числе, но не ограничиваясь этим 555 базическим аккордеоном, таким как инструмент, что этот конкретный автор просто не может насытиться!